Housing in 98144 Seattle, WA is more expensive than the national median value of $338,100. The median value for housing in this area is $768,500 and the house appreciation rate over the last year has been 4.00%, much lower than the US 1 year house appreciation rate of 8.27%. This suggests that while expensive, housing in 98144 Seattle, WA is not appreciating as quickly as other areas throughout the United States.

The median home cost in Seattle (zip 98144) is $768,500.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 142.4%. Home Appreciation in Seattle (zip 98144) is up 10.8%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Seattle (zip 98144) real estate is 55 years old
The Rental Market in Seattle (zip 98144)
- Renters make up 48.4% of the Seattle (zip 98144) population
- 0.9% of houses and apartments in Seattle (zip 98144), are available to rent
